Frequently asked questions: Holy shit vs Wow
What's the difference between Holy shit and Wow?
Holy shit: A strong expression of surprise or shock. Wow: A word used to express surprise or excitement.
Which is more formal: Holy shit and Wow?
Wow is the most formal of these.
Which is more common: Holy shit and Wow?
Wow is the most common in everyday English.
Can you show an example of each?
Holy shit: Holy shit! I can't believe we won the lottery! Wow: Wow! You look terrific!
Can I use Holy shit and Wow interchangeably?
Not always. Holy shit and Wow are related and overlap in some contexts, but they differ in register, how common they are, and usage, so swapping one for another can change the meaning or tone. Check the differences above before substituting.
